1. A braking force generation device comprising:
a cross flow fan on a trailing edge side of a wing;
a deflector above the cross flow fan, the deflector being capable of being retracted with respect to the wing, and having a leading edge and a trailing edge such that both of the leading edge and the trailing edge are capable of being separated from the wing; and
a blocker door below the cross flow fan, the blocker door being configured to rotate with one end side fixed to the wing as a center, and capable of being retracted or deployed with respect to the wing,
wherein the braking force generation device is configured to have:
a first mode in which the deflector and the blocker door are retracted with respect to the wing;
a second mode in which, in a state where: (i) the leading edge of the deflector is separated from the wing; (ii) the trailing edge of the deflector is at or adjacent to the wing; and (iii) the blocker door is deployed; a first flow path is formed on a lower surface side of the deflector for fluid to flow from a rear of the wing to a front of the wing via the cross flow fan from an opening on a blocker door side to a leading edge opening on a leading edge side of the deflector in the first flow path; and
a third mode in which, in a state where: (i) the leading edge of the deflector is separated from the wing; (ii) the trailing edge of the deflector is separated from the wing; and (iii) the blocker door is retracted: a second flow path is formed on the lower surface side of the deflector for the fluid to flow from the front of the wing to the rear of the wing via the cross flow fan from the leading edge opening on the leading edge side of the deflector to a trailing edge opening on a trailing edge side of the deflector in the second flow path, and
wherein:
the second flow path provides communication between the leading edge opening and the trailing edge opening;
the leading edge opening is defined between the deflector and the wing and forward of the cross flow fan; and
the trailing edge opening is defined between the deflector and the wing and rearward of the cross flow fan.
